Wheels Up Advances Fleet Modernization Plan with Strategic Sale-Leaseback Transaction and Satellite Wi-Fi Milestone
Prnewswire· 2025-12-23 13:00
Core Insights - Wheels Up Experience Inc. has announced a sale-leaseback transaction for part of its aircraft fleet, marking a significant step in its fleet modernization strategy aimed at enhancing customer experience and supporting growth in 2026 [1][4][5] Fleet Modernization Strategy - The company is focused on scaling its fleet of Bombardier Challenger 300 series and Embraer Phenom 300 series aircraft, with strong demand for its new fleet offerings linked to the recently launched Signature membership [2][6] - In the fourth quarter, Wheels Up has acquired or entered into agreements to acquire 10 additional Challenger and Phenom aircraft, with plans for further expansion in 2026 [2] Sale-Leaseback Transaction - Wheels Up has entered into an agreement to sell 3 Challenger 300s and 7 Phenom 300s, while entering into long-term operating leases for all 10 aircraft, ensuring continued operation and access for customers [3][4] - The sale price for this transaction is approximately $105 million, with expected proceeds used to repay $65 million of outstanding debt and provide $40 million in cash to the company's balance sheet [4] Customer Experience Enhancement - The first Phenom 300 equipped with Gogo Galileo HDX satellite Wi-Fi has entered service, initiating a fleet-wide upgrade to next-generation connectivity, which enhances in-flight performance and customer experience [5][6] - The company anticipates delivering its first HDX-equipped Challenger aircraft early in 2026, with plans to quickly upgrade the entire fleet throughout the year [6]
Wheels Up Announces Third Quarter Results
Prnewswire· 2025-11-05 11:55
Core Insights - Wheels Up Experience Inc. reported a revenue of $185.5 million for Q3 2025, a decrease of 4% year-over-year, primarily due to reduced flight revenue from discontinued membership programs [6][9] - The company achieved total gross bookings of $266.6 million, reflecting a 5% increase year-over-year, driven by a 14% growth in on-demand charter offerings [6][9] - The company is focused on fleet modernization, with the Phenom 300 becoming the largest fleet type in revenue service and the Challenger fleet reaching programmatic scale [4][6] Financial Performance - The net loss for Q3 2025 was $83.7 million, or $(0.12) per share, compared to a net loss of $57.7 million in Q3 2024, representing a 45% increase in losses [6][9][18] - Adjusted EBITDA loss was $23.2 million, while Adjusted EBITDAR loss was $19.7 million, both impacted by transitory fleet inefficiencies [6][9] - The company reported a quarter-end liquidity of $225 million, including $125 million in cash and cash equivalents [6][9] Operational Highlights - Wheels Up achieved a completion rate of 99% and an on-time performance of 89%, marking improvements of 1 percentage point and 4 percentage points year-over-year, respectively [7][9] - The company expects nearly 50% of its premium jet fleet to consist of Phenom and Challenger aircraft by the end of 2025, with a complete fleet transition anticipated by year-end 2026 [7][9] - The successful launch of the Signature Membership program has contributed to strong sales, with nearly 20% of total block sales for September and October coming from this new offering [7][9] Strategic Initiatives - Productivity initiatives are projected to exceed the original goal of $50 million, with expected annual run-rate cost savings of $70 million or more starting in Q1 2026 [6][9] - The company raised approximately $50 million in equity capital during Q3 2025 to support its fleet modernization program and general corporate purposes [7][9] - Wheels Up sold three non-core services businesses for $21.5 million, further streamlining operations and focusing on its fleet modernization strategy [8][9]
Wheels Up Elevates In-Flight Dining with AtYourJet
Prnewswire· 2025-10-22 13:01
Core Insights - Wheels Up Experience Inc. has announced a strategic partnership with AtYourJet and Chef Robert Irvine to enhance the in-flight dining experience for its Signature Members, introducing a digital ordering platform and chef-curated menus [1][3][4] Group 1: Partnership and Offerings - The partnership aims to elevate private jet dining standards, providing complimentary dining options for Wheels Up Signature Members and purchasable options for other flyers [1][2] - Two menu tiers will be available: a Complimentary Menu featuring classic favorites and a Premium A La Carte Menu that will rotate seasonally in ten key markets, with plans for expansion [2][4] Group 2: Culinary Expertise and Innovation - Chef Robert Irvine, a long-time Wheels Up member, brings culinary expertise to the collaboration, ensuring that dishes are designed for seamless transition from kitchen to cabin [3][5] - AtYourJet's digital ordering platform and extensive kitchen network will enhance consistency and quality control, addressing a common pain point in private aviation catering [3][5][6] Group 3: Membership Benefits - The new Wheels Up Signature Membership offers year-round access to a premium fleet, with flexible plan options starting at a $200,000 minimum deposit plus a small monthly fee [4] - Members can choose between the Dynamic Access Plan for flexibility and the Fixed Access Plan for consistent rates, along with access to exclusive events and experiences [4] Group 4: Company Background - Wheels Up is a leading provider of on-demand private aviation in the U.S., offering a diverse fleet and a global network of safety-vetted charter operators [7] - AtYourJet, founded in 2022, focuses on high-quality, locally sourced meals and aims to disrupt the private jet catering market with its digital platform [6][8]
